    The go get a lawyer and have him write you a letter asking for EXACTLY what damage was done and with full disclosure and for what cause.


    $10K is a LOT of damage. And yes, it can be concealed depending on where it's at.

    The other option you have is to go in to the office, forget even trying to call.

    And ask the manager to see the alleged damage AND the video showing the damage.


    THAT is YOUR biggest error is you did NOT see the evidence that they are using against you.
